Abstract

The utility model relates to a multi-jack electric connector in the field of connectors, which comprises an insulating shell, wherein a plurality of jack parts which are communicated back and forth are arranged in the insulating shell, a supporting plate is arranged on the surface of the insulating shell, a connecting hole which is communicated with the jack parts is arranged on the surface of the supporting plate, a clamping groove is arranged in the insulating shell, the clamping groove penetrates through the jack parts, a fixing piece is arranged in the clamping groove, one end of the fixing piece is provided with a handle, the handle extends to the outer side of the insulating shell, one end of the insulating shell, which is close to the handle, is provided with a compression screw, a nut of the compression screw extends to the surface of the insulating shell, one end of the compression screw, which is far away from the nut, is compressed on the surface of the fixing piece, a plurality of clamping blocks are arranged on the fixing piece, the fixing piece is arranged, the conducting wire is connected with the insulating shell, and the fixing piece can clamp the conducting wires in all the jack parts at the same time, so that the use is more convenient, time and labor are saved, and the dismounting efficiency is improved.

Background
An electrical connector is a connecting device for electrically connecting wires, a circuit board and other electronic components, and is widely used in various electronic products, such as computers, notebook computers, mobile phones and various electronic products, and can transmit electric current or transmit electric signals.

Compared with the prior art, the utility model has the beneficial effects that: be provided with the mounting, be connected wire and insulating casing through the mounting, insert insulating casing with the mounting during the use in with the clamp block alignment socket portion, press the mounting through the handle after the wire inserts the socket portion, make the inner wall of clamp block and socket portion press from both sides tight wire, twist tightly the hold-down screw afterwards, make the fixed position of mounting can complete wire be connected with insulating casing, loosen the hold-down screw can pull out the wire, can press from both sides the wire in all socket portions simultaneously through the mounting, it is more convenient to use, labour saving and time saving, improve the efficiency of dismouting.

The multi-jack electric connector of the embodiment is provided with the fixing piece 6, the wire is connected with the insulating shell 1 through the fixing piece 6, the fixing piece 6 is inserted into the insulating shell 1 and the clamping blocks 9 are opposite to the Ji Chakou part 2 during use, after the wire is inserted into the jack part 2, the fixing piece 6 is pressed through the handle 7, the clamping blocks 9 are enabled to clamp the wire with the inner wall of the jack part 2, then the compression screw 8 is twisted tightly, the position of the fixing piece 6 is fixed, the wire can be completely connected with the insulating shell 1, the compression screw 8 is loosened during disassembly, the wire can be pulled out, the wires in all the jack parts 2 can be clamped simultaneously through the fixing piece 6, the use is more convenient, time and labor are saved, and the disassembly efficiency is improved.
